1. Materials and Tools Needed for Grandma’s Checkered Pants Crochet – Pattern

Before diving into your Grandma’s Checkered Pants Crochet – Pattern, it’s important to gather the right materials and tools. Choosing high-quality supplies ensures that your final piece looks professional, feels comfortable, and lasts for years to come.

Start with the yarn. Medium-weight yarn (category 4) is typically ideal for crochet pants because it provides the right balance between flexibility and structure. Cotton blends are excellent for breathable, everyday wear, while acrylic yarn offers warmth and durability for cooler weather. For a truly vintage look, consider using natural fibers like wool or bamboo.

The signature feature of the Grandma’s Checkered Pants Crochet – Pattern is its checkered design. Choose two or more contrasting colors to create the squares. Classic combinations like black and white or brown and beige work beautifully, but you can also experiment with bright, fun colors for a modern twist. Using leftover yarns from other projects is also a great way to make these pants sustainable and unique.

You’ll need a crochet hook suitable for your yarn—usually a 4.0 mm (G) or 4.5 mm (7) hook works well. Always check your gauge before starting, as tension plays a big role in achieving the correct fit. A measuring tape, stitch markers, scissors, and a yarn needle are also essential for this project.

A comfortable waistband requires elastic or a drawstring. Depending on your preference, you can crochet a drawstring from yarn or use store-bought elastic for convenience. Make sure to measure your waist accurately for a perfect fit.

Finally, keep a notebook or digital tracker to record color sequences and stitch counts. The Grandma’s Checkered Pants Crochet – Pattern involves alternating colors, so having a reference helps maintain consistency throughout your project.

2. Step-by-Step Guide to Making Grandma’s Checkered Pants Crochet – Pattern

Creating the Grandma’s Checkered Pants Crochet – Pattern may seem complex at first, but it’s easy to follow when broken into simple steps. The pattern generally consists of crocheting individual granny squares and joining them to form the pants.

Start by crocheting your granny squares. Each square will make up a section of your checkered design. To begin, chain four stitches and join them into a loop. Then work a series of double crochets and chain spaces to form the square. Alternate your yarn colors for each round to create the checkered effect. You’ll need around 30–40 squares for an adult-sized pair of pants, depending on your measurements.

Once you’ve finished the squares, block them to ensure they are uniform in size. Blocking helps each square lay flat, making assembly easier and more precise. Use pins and a steam iron or water spray to shape them evenly before letting them dry.

Next, join the squares. You can use a whip stitch or slip stitch join, depending on your preference. Arrange them in a layout that fits your measurements, forming two panels for the legs and a larger panel for the waistband and hips. Join the pieces carefully, keeping your seams neat and consistent.

After the legs are assembled, join them together at the center. This is where the pants begin to take shape. Try them on to check the fit before completing the waistband. Adjust the number of squares or rows if needed for a comfortable fit.

Finish by crocheting the waistband. You can use single crochet or half-double crochet stitches for a sturdy band. Insert elastic or crochet a drawstring for flexibility. Weave in all ends neatly and give your Grandma’s Checkered Pants Crochet – Pattern one final steam block to refine the shape and texture.

4. Tips and Tricks for Perfecting Grandma’s Checkered Pants Crochet – Pattern

Every crochet project benefits from a few expert tips, and the Grandma’s Checkered Pants Crochet – Pattern is no exception. With a bit of patience and attention to detail, you can achieve stunning results.

First, always make a gauge swatch. Since pants need to fit comfortably, an accurate gauge ensures that your project won’t turn out too tight or too loose. Take time to measure your stitches and adjust your hook size if needed.

Second, weave in your ends as you go. The checkered pattern involves frequent color changes, and leaving all ends for the end of the project can become overwhelming. Finishing them as you progress keeps your work tidy and manageable.

Third, be mindful of stretch. Crochet fabric tends to expand slightly with wear, especially around the waist and hips. Adding an elastic band or a drawstring helps maintain shape and comfort over time.

Fourth, use sturdy joining techniques. Since the pants are made of squares, the seams must be durable. A flat slip-stitch join not only looks neat but also provides flexibility for movement. Avoid joins that are too tight, as they can cause strain on the fabric.

Fifth, block your pants after finishing. This final step gives your Grandma’s Checkered Pants Crochet – Pattern a professional look. Blocking smooths out stitches, aligns seams, and enhances the checkered texture.

Lastly, don’t rush the process. Crochet pants require time and patience, but the reward is a one-of-a-kind piece that reflects your dedication and creativity. Enjoy each stitch and take pride in the craftsmanship that goes into making these charming pants.

FAQ About Grandma’s Checkered Pants Crochet – Pattern

Q1: Is the Grandma’s Checkered Pants Crochet – Pattern suitable for beginners?
Yes! While it looks intricate, the design mainly uses basic stitches like double crochet and chain stitches. Beginners can easily follow along with patience.

Q2: How long does it take to make a pair of crochet pants?
Depending on your skill level and speed, it can take between one and two weeks of casual crocheting to complete a full pair.

Q3: What yarn works best for this pattern?
Medium-weight cotton or acrylic yarn is ideal. Cotton provides breathability, while acrylic offers warmth and structure.

Q4: Can I customize the color scheme?
Absolutely. The checkered pattern encourages creativity—choose any color combination that fits your style or season.

Q5: How do I wash my crochet pants?
Handwash gently in cold water and lay flat to dry. Avoid wringing or machine washing to preserve shape and texture.

Q6: Can I sell pants made from this pattern?
Yes, handmade crochet pants are popular in the handmade fashion market. Just ensure you credit the original designer if you’re using their exact pattern.
